2 1/4 lb Banana

2 tb Sugar, granulated

1 c Milk, whole

2 c Water

1 c Arrowroot

1 Coconut

Peel and break up bananas. Put into pot, add water and boil until a purplish colour. Take off heat and cool. Pour mixture into a big bowl and when cold mash and add arrowroot, sugar and milk. Butter a baking dish and pour in mixture to bake at 180^-200^C (360-400^F). Coconut juice: Grate coconut and add 3/4 cup hot water and strain – extracting the milk. Take the baked mixture and cut into medium sized squares. Pour on juice to soak into the poke. Source: The Maori Cookbook, From The Cookie Lady’s Files.
